3. He likes bees, but prefers Mothra.
In "The Big Bang Theory," "Bazinga!" is Sheldon's favorite exclamation, a cue that he's just pulled one over on whomever he's speaking to. In real life, a team of Brazilian scientists named a newly-discovered species of orchid bee, Euglossa bazinga, in honor of the show and Sheldon himself.
In response to the announcement, executive producer Steven Molaro said, "Sheldon would be honored to know that Euglossa bazinga was inspired by him. In fact, after Mothra and griffins, bees are his third-favorite flying creature."
